The Five-SeveN | Violent Daimyo (Field-Tested) is a highly accurate and armor-piercing pistol, known for its generous 20-round magazine and forgiving recoil. This skin features a custom graphic design in violet and black, adding a unique flair to its functionality.
The Five-SeveN | Violent Daimyo was introduced to CS2 on June 15th, 2016, as part of the Gamma Case during the "Gamma Exposure" update. It was created by the community designer known as "The Honey Badger."
This skin showcases a "Custom Paint Job" style with a predominant purple tint. Its design allows for a range of customized looks, although different pattern indexes do not affect the Violent Daimyo finish.
The float value for the Five-SeveN | Violent Daimyo (Field-Tested) ranges from 0.15 to 0.37, indicating that its design may show moderate wear, providing a balance between quality and aesthetic appeal.

The skin is categorized as Mil-Spec Grade, which means it is among the more common drops in CS2, with an estimated drop chance of 79.92%. This rarity denotes that while it is accessible, it still retains a level of desirability.
The Five-SeveN | Violent Daimyo can be obtained by opening a Gamma Case container, with a drop chance of approximately 79.92%, making it a fairly common item to acquire.
